Physiotherapy services (pediatric physical therapy) consist of a variety of health care treatments which are designed to relieve mobility, injuries, and disabilities of individuals. This is usually performed by a licensed physical therapist (or also called a physiotherapist), who has extensive training in the area of medicine and orthopedics. These types of services focus on the diagnosis, prevention, and treatment of disorders of the musculoskeletal system. The treatment may be manual therapy, stretching exercises, laser therapy, electrical stimulation, heat therapy, or ultrasound therapy. Manual therapies used by a physiotherapy specialist involve manipulating the patient's muscles, tendons, ligaments, bones, or joints. They use specific techniques such as strengthening the muscles around the injured area, reducing tension in the muscles, or increasing the range of motion of a joint.
